A celebration of the food, music, and culture of the region is this weekend as part of the North Delta Ramble.

Event founder AlanBrockman say his ongoing passion is to promote and spotlight the area's unique sense of Americana through it's culture.  "We wanted to bring attention to great styles of music and share the story of the food and culture that make this region so special," saysBrockman.

Brockman and a film crew presented the first installment of the Ramble on Louisiana Public Broadcasting earlier this week.   "It is a day-in-the-life approach in following a chef and artist that culminates in a celebration," saidBrockman.  The crew films the barn party Saturday for another installment to air in August.
